How to Transfer a Domain Away
If you need to move your domain from dotCanada to another registrar, we'll help make the process as smooth as possible. Here's what you need to do.
Step 1: Unlock Your Domain
Before initiating a transfer at your new registrar, you must disable the Transfer Lock on your domain. Log in to your dotCanada client area, navigate to Domains, select your domain, and turn off the Transfer Lock.
Step 2: Get Your EPP/Auth Code
Your new registrar will ask for an EPP code (also called an authorization code or auth code) to verify that you have permission to transfer the domain. You can request this code directly from your dotCanada client area:
- Go to Domains and click on the domain you're transferring.
- Find the EPP Code or Authorization Code option and request it.
- The code will be emailed to the administrative contact address on file for the domain.
Step 3: Initiate the Transfer at Your New Registrar
Follow your new registrar's process for incoming transfers. You'll enter your domain name and EPP code. Once submitted, you may receive an email asking you to confirm the transfer - be sure to approve it promptly.
What to Expect
Transfers typically take 5–7 days. Your domain will continue to resolve normally throughout the process. Once complete, management of the domain moves to your new registrar.
